On the p-rank of singular curves and their smooth models

Published 13 Sep 2023 in math.AG | (2309.06901v2)

Abstract: In this paper, we are concerned with the computation of the $p$-rank and $a$-number of singular curves and their smooth model. We consider a pair $X, X'$ of proper curves over an algebraically closed field $k$ of characteristic $p$, where $X'$ is a singular curve which lies on a smooth projective variety, particularly on smooth projective surfaces $S$ (with $p_g(S) = 0 = q(S)$) and $X$ is the smooth model of $X'$. We determine the $p$-rank of $X$ by using the exact sequence of group schemes relating the Jacobians $J_X$ and $J_{X'}$. As an application, we determine a relation about the fundamental invariants $p$-rank and $a$-number of a family of singular curves and their smooth models. Moreover, we calculate $a$-number and find lower bound for $p$-rank of a family of smooth curves.
